Dying Wish announce debut album “Fragments Of A Bitter Memory”

July 8, 2021

Dying Wish is the Portland-based blistering hardcore five-piece whose passionate music fuses New Wave of American Heavy Metal and chaos-driven punk noises. Late last year, they signed to SharpTone Records and today, have announced the release of their forthcoming record, “Fragments of a Bitter Memory” which will be released on October 1, 2021 via their new label home. Pre-orders are available now here. To celebrate the announcement, Dying Wish has released the record’s title track “Fragments of a Bitter Memory”. On the deeply personal new single, lead vocalist Emma Boster shares: “‘Fragments’ starts by taking the listener back to my first memory. I was five years old and I was the flower girl at my mother’s wedding. My biological father wasn’t in my life and the man she was marrying took a vow to fill that void. Over the next decade I watched that same man who I had learned to call my father become a violent alcoholic. Lionheart bring summer festival feeling into your home with the release of their live record

November 6, 2020

  Bay Area’s (CA) reigning kings of heavy hardcore first stormed into the scene in 2007 with their debut album: »The Will To Survive«. Taking influence from bands like BLOOD FOR BLOOD, HATEBREED, and MADBALL; LIONHEART came out swinging with a full-blown assault of blistering metallic hardcore. They quickly followed it up with 2010’s »Built On Struggle«, 2012’s »Undisputed« and years of nonstop touring. Following a short break after their release »Undisputed«, the band came back stronger than ever with 2014’s »Welcome To The Westcoast«. The album debuted at #1 on both iTunes Metal and GooglePlay Metal Charts. LIONHEART stormed into the scene again in January 2016 with »Love Don’t Live here«. The album title, a nod to a classic R&B/ Motown song by the same name, shows the bands unwillingness to conform to the typical „hardcore mold“, as well as the bitter and unforgiving lyrical content the band is known for. Lionheart record release show in Munich – SOLD OUT!

December 10, 2019

Lionheart released their latest record ‘Valley Of Death’ on November 15th, 2019. That very same day the Lionheart tour made a stop in Munich. They brought along Deez Nutz, Kublai Kahn, Obey The Brave and Fallbrawl. In good old Lionheart fashion they tore down the place (in a good way). Lionheart and Deez Nuts both come here once a year at least. Every time the shows are packed and the place is cooking. Both bands connect well with the audience. The dynamics were mind-blowing. Especially venues of that size, where the stage isn’t that big and the pit isn’t that wide, give the audience the feeling of being close to the show and being part of it. Constant mosh pits, circle pits and stage divers kept the security guys pretty busy. But that’s what makes those shows special and makes people come back. Everyone is out to have a good time and with the line-up that night, they surely weren’t disappointed. Lionheart – ‘Valley Of Death’, tour and special release shows

November 11, 2019

The Lionheart European tour is already underway. The release date of their upcoming record ‘Valley Of Death’ is only days away. Two shows on the current tour will be special album release shows – Munich on November 15th and Wiesbaden on the 22nd. Both dates are low on tickets, so better be quick. We already had the chance to listen to the new record in full. Four songs have been released over the last few weeks – ‘Valley Of Death’, ‘Burn’, ‘Rock Bottom, feat. Jesse Barnett from STYG’ and ‘Born Feet First’. ‘Valley Of Death’ is Lionheart’s 7th studio record. Their last record ‘Welcome To The West Coast II’ has been #1 on the iTunes Metal Charts and Google Play Metal charts. The upcoming album definitely has the potential to storm the charts again. You get about 25 minutes of groovy Hardcore with heavy riffs. Ten songs, uncompromising and no time to catch your breath in between.
